Common merit-aid mistakes at Mars Hill

  1. MHU does not publish amounts or GPA/test cutoffs for its named academic scholarships (Bailey, Blue and Gold, Presidential). The only dollar figure on the site is an indirect reference on the Blackwell page to 'academic merit scholarships ranging from $17,000-$19,000 annually.' Families must wait for the aid package to know their award.

  2. The promise is a 'minimum of a 50 percent discount on tuition' only — it does not apply to the comprehensive fee or the $13,006 food & housing charge in the $53,484 total cost of attendance.

The scholarships page says recipients 'are required to maintain a designated minimum college grade point average (GPA) to continue receiving the scholarship each semester,' but the designated GPA is not published anywhere on the pages reviewed. Ask the aid office for the exact renewal GPA in writing.

  4. MHU's SAP policy states students not meeting the standards 'are not eligible for federal, state, or institutional aid' — meaning merit scholarships are also cut off, with GPA floors of 1.50 (freshman), 1.80 (sophomore), and 2.00 (junior+) plus minimum earned-hours requirements.

  5. It is competitive: it requires a separate application, an interview, one recommendation, a 3.5 high school GPA, and North Carolina residency — and it is 'up to $3000,' not a guaranteed $3,000.

Mars Hill merit aid FAQ

  • What is the scholarship application deadline?

    No scholarship deadline is published on the financial-aid or scholarships pages reviewed (retrieved 2026-06-07). The competitive scholarships (Blackwell, Honors, Bonner) use one shared application form. Ask the aid office for the priority date for the 2026-2027 entry cycle.

  • Do I need to file the FAFSA to get merit aid?

    The scholarships page says 'After you have completed the FAFSA, we will be in touch with you to let you know the details of the financial aid package for which you have qualified,' and the Bonner program explicitly requires FAFSA-demonstrated need. The page does not state whether the academic merit scholarships themselves require FAFSA — confirm with the aid office. MHU's federal school code is 002944.

  • How much does Mars Hill cost for 2026-2027?

    Total cost of attendance is $53,484: tuition $40,228 (includes required textbooks), comprehensive student fee $250, and food & housing $13,006.

  • Is there a guaranteed scholarship for local students?

    Yes. The Local Lion Promise guarantees a minimum 50 percent discount on tuition for traditional undergraduates who live or attend high school in Avery, Buncombe, Haywood, Henderson, Madison, Mitchell, McDowell, Transylvania, or Yancey county, NC.
